• # + d'infos

    Posté par  . Évalué à 2.

    En éditant le .ram j'ai trouvé ça : rtsp://a624.v107971106989320.c10797.g.vr.akamaistream.net/ondemand/(...)

    C'est un .rm
    Ca aide un peu?
    • [^] # Re: + d'infos

      Posté par  (site web personnel) . Évalué à 2.

      streamripper vlc mplayer, mencoder.

      le premier portes bien son nom.
      Mplayer as une option speciale; exemple pour une radio web:
      mplayer -ao pcm -aofile /tmp/radio_$1.`date +%F_%H-%M-%S`.pcm
      Vlc je serais etonne qu il ne fasse pas comme mplayer.
    • [^] # Re: + d'infos

      Posté par  (site web personnel) . Évalué à 0.

      Y a une astuce qui est passée y a pas longtemps, qui expliquait comment "dumper" un flux real media avec mplayer ou mencoder.
  • # Début de solution

    Posté par  . Évalué à 4.

    Après des recherches :

    Tout d'abord, récupérer le fichier au format RealPlayer. Clic droit, "Enregistrer sous" ou autre. Stocker ce fichier .ram sur votre disque dur. Ce fichier contient l'adresse du flux Real diffusé sur un serveur utilisant le protocole rtsp.

    Mplayer permet de communiquer en rtsp.

    Pour écouter l'émission en ligne de commande, tapez simplement (en supposant que le fichier ram récupéré s'appelle RDE20050129.ram) :
    mplayer -nocache -playlist RDE20050129.ram

    Si vous souhaitez conserver le flux sur le disque dur utilisez cette ligne :
    mplayer -dumpstream -dumpfile emissiondu2901.rm -nocache -playlist RDE20050129.ram
    Mplayer n'affiche aucun indicateur de progression, mais vous pourrez constater que vous avez bien un fichier emissiondu2901.rm qui grossit.

    Reste à convertir ce fichier Realplayer en .ogg ....
    • [^] # Re: Début de solution

      Posté par  . Évalué à 2.

      Toujours avec mplayer, pour faire un .wav
      mplayer -ao pcm -aofile emissiondu2901.wav -nocache -playlist RDE20050129.ram

      et hop, maintenat on peut convertir en .ogg :
      oggenc emissiondu2901.wav
  • # Autre solution

    Posté par  . Évalué à 2.

    Avec vsound :
    Vsound capture le son de n'importe quelle application et l'enregistre en wav

    Tout d'abord, enregistrer le fichier .ram sur votre disque. Celui-ci contient l'adresse du flux Real.

    Ensuite, prodédez à l'enregistrement de l'émission
    vsound -d realplay RDE20050129.ram
    Cette commande démarre Realplayer et en capture le flux audio.
    Vous écoutez l'émisssion tout en l'enregistrant. Si vous ne voulez pas entre le son, enlevez "-d" à la commande.
    A la fin de l'enregistrement un fichier vsound.wav est enregistré sur votre disque.

    Pour le convertir en .ogg tapez :
    oggenc vsound.wav
    Un fichier vsound.ogg est créé.

    Cette solution est assez pratique mais plusieurs défauts apparaissent:
    1. Le temps d'enregistrement est égal au temps d'écoute de l'émisssion. Ca peut faire long, en l'occurence 50 min pour cet exemple.
    2. Le fichier Real est encodé à 20 kbps. En Ogg, pour avoir la même qualité audio, il faut 70 kbps. Je suis très déçu par cette différence de performance (rapport de 3.5/1).

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.